Carbon dioxide: Source: The decarboxylation of respiratory substrates during aerobic respiration in mitochondria , Effect if accumulates in body: Cells damaged if blood pH falls below normal range (acidosis), Ammonia: Source: The deamination of excess amino acids in liver cells, Effect if accumulates in body: Increases cytoplasm pH and interferes with metabolic processes (i.e. respiration) and receptors for neurotransmitters in the brain., Urea: Source: The ornithine cycle in liver cells, Effect if accumulates in body: Urea readily diffuses into cells. This decreases their water potential, causing them to absorb water by osmosis and expand until they burst., Uric acid: Source: The breaking down of adenine and guanine (purines) in the liver., Effect if accumulates in body: Uric acid may form crystals in joints, causing gout., Bile pigments: Source: The breaking down of the haem groups of haemoglobin in liver cells., Effect if accumulates in body: Bile pigments accumulate under the skin turning it yellow (jaundice).,
